For booboosmum

In Explorer, go to c:\windows, scroll down to near the end, where you will find "win.ini", doubleclick on it, Notepad will open. The second or third line from the top will say run=hpfsched or something like that.
change it into only run=
Click on File (at the top), select "Save" and select Exit.
Next time you reboot (no need to do it straight away) it will no longer run.
All it does is notify you for updates for your HP printer, unnecessary!.

Looks clean, except one.

Download and run:

http://cexx.org/lspfix.htm

Now use these instructions to remove the bad DLL:

1. Run LSPFix.
2. Check 'I know what I'm doing'.
3. Select 'xfire_lsp_8742.dll'.
4. Click the right-pointing arrow (moves it to the "remove" page).
5. Click 'Finished'.
6. Restart your computer in "Safe Mode" (F5 or F8 when starting Windows).
7. Delete the following file: 'xfire_lsp_8742.dll'
8. Restart your computer and bring it up in normal mode.
